Is teeth whitening for everyone?
Not everyone’s teeth are suitable for whitening. Your teeth and gums have to be in a healthy condition before you go for teeth whitening procedures. Even if you have healthy teeth, there may be other reasons why whitening won’t work. 

How can I find out if my teeth are suitable for whitening?
The best way to know if your teeth are suitable for whitening is to see your dentist first. A qualified dentist can make an accurate assessment of your teeth and gums. He will check for things like enamel thickness, existing sensitivity, receding gums, existing tooth decay, any other oral diseases or conditions. Dental implants-why they are considered better?
Dental implants are considered the best treatment for replacing missing or non-restorable teeth. They consist of a small titanium post that is placed in the jaw bone to act as tooth root. Eventually, the titanium post bonds to the surrounding bone through a process called Osseointegration. After healing has occurred, an abutment is screwed into the implant and a crown is placed onto the abutment. What is Sedation Dentistry?

Sedation dentistry is the use of different types of sedatives to make an anxious patient relax while the dentist performs the dental procedure. Sedative drugs (tranquillizers, depressants, anti-anxiety medications, nitrous oxide, etc.) can be administered in a variety of ways-orally, intra-venously and by inhalation.

Sedation not just makes a patient relaxed, but also makes the procedure easier for the dentists, allowing them to concentrate on performing the dental treatment in the best possible manner.

What is CEREC?

CEREC is an acronym for Chairside Economical Restoration of Esthetic Ceramics. It allows a dental practitioner to produce an indirect ceramic dental restoration using a variety of computer assisted technologies, including 3D photography and CAD/CAM. With CEREC, teeth can be restored in a single sitting with the patient, rather than the multiple sittings required with earlier techniques.

Gum Disease And Laser Treatment



Periodontitis, or gum disease is caused by a combination of different types of bacteria. Periodontitis results from an interaction between bacteria and body's immune system. Lack of proper oral hygiene results in plaque, which collects on the teeth at the gum line; this plaque harbors many bacteria, which eventually calcifies to form tartar. This tartar causes inflammation of Gum tissues and ulceration, which we commonly known as gum disease. Gum Diseases-Why should you worry?
Gum diseases are a cause of big worry as they cause destruction of periodontal tissues and tooth-supporting bone, ultimately leading to tooth loss.

Treatment of gum diseases
Treatment of gum disease is aimed at controlling the cause. Once control of gum disease has been established through initial therapy, surgical treatment may be suggested, depending on the condition of your gums, to regenerate a healthy periodontal attachment to the teeth. Initial treatment includes disruption of the bio-film with the help of scaling. Laser technology-a revolutionary treatment for gum diseases
Laser technology is being touted as the next big thing in the treatment of gum diseases. According to the studies, it can adjunct to or serve as replacement for the conventional nonsurgical therapy. Treatment using lasers is based on its ability to perform sub-gingival curettage (removing tissue by scraping or scooping), the removal of the inflamed pocket lining and significantly decrease sub-gingival bacteria. 

Advantages of laser treatment
Advantages of laser treatment over conventional methods include:
·         Minimal tissue damage and swelling
·         Reduces bleeding
·         Sterilization of the treatment area
·         Reduced post-treatment discomfort

How does plaque lead to cavities?
The plaque formed by bacteria is not removed by saliva or brushing. It produces acids that dissolve the minerals, making enamel porous. Eventually big holes are formed on your teeth, which are known as cavities.
